# Insurance Renewal — Managers Only

This page covers the upcoming renewal of Brastelle Group's commercial liability and errors-and-omissions coverage, handled through Mirefield Underwriters. Premiums are projected to rise roughly 11% given last year's claims in the Dunmore territory. Sales leads should avoid committing to indemnity terms beyond our standard clauses until the new policy binds on the first of the quarter. Keldra Voss owns the negotiation. The confidential context for this renewal is noted below.

internal memo for yahap-badug: Headcount on the Zorys team goes from 28 to 129 by the end of March. Gross margin on Zorys came in at 40 percent against a plan of 48 percent.

Splitting the user module out of the Harrowgate monolith lands in two phases: read traffic first, then writes. Projected load on the new Ledgerline service is roughly 40% of current monolith QPS, peaking during the Ostvale morning window. Connection pools and cache sizing for the initial rollout are set by the constants below.

limits module of fajog-kahag:
QUOTAS = {
    "druael": 1,
    "zorath": 10,
    "druath": 1,
    "druwyn": 5,
}

Purgeline is Halverton Systems' data-retention sweeper. It walks archival stores nightly and deletes records past their policy window, so mistakes are irreversible — treat every release with care. As a maintainer you will eventually cut releases yourself: tag the commit, run the reproducibility check, and attach the signed manifest. Verification is mandatory on every node before the sweeper is allowed to run with delete permissions enabled. All production nodes validate artifacts against the maintainer signing key reproduced below.

deploy key for kajof-fajop: bky6_gDHw9Q

**How do Fanegate flag rollouts work?**

Flags roll out by percentage cohort, not per account. A customer stuck on old behavior is likely outside the cohort, not broken — check the flag name in the diagnostics panel before filing a ticket. Cohort assignment is sticky per session. Current rollout percentages for every active flag are listed on the page below.

dashboard of bafof-hafog = https://confluence.lumiclabs.internal/display/browse/display/6a09a20a